CERAMIC SCULPTURES
At the core of my work is a dedication to handcrafting, expressing sensitivity through visual languages and narratives.
With the clay, I craft biomorphic forms with care, using the coiling technique.
UTILITARIAN SCULPTURES
Influenced by artists such as Valentine Schlegel, my work explores the intersectionality of art, craft, and design, particularly through functional pieces like lamps and vases.
HOMES FOR PLANTS
The ideal of home for greenery echoes a wish to cultivate care, roots, and connection. For the Mushroom Church concert set design, I incorporated my sculptures with plants and fungi whose sounds, by biodata sonification, invited the audience to sense a deeper bond with nature as a whole.
